Recently, Avantika University hosted the 5th Convocation Ceremony marking a momentous occasion. SAMAHVAN 2025 - 5th Convocation Ceremony, was an event of joy and encouragement that featured a virtual inauguration of the murti (idol) of Vagdevi ji by Dr. Mohan Yadav, Hon'ble Chief Minister of Madhya Pradesh, setting a spiritual tone for the graduating class of innovators and professionals. 

Distinguished Guests at this Historical Milestone

The ceremony brought together visionaries who are shaping India's education ecosystem:

  1. Chief Guest: Dr Mohan Yadav, Chief Minister of Madhya Pradesh - He virtually inaugurated the sacred Vagdevi ji Murti, the symbol of knowledge and wisdom on Avantika's campus.
  2. Guest of Honour: Srimathi Shivashankar, Corporate Vice President & Global Business Head, HCLTech EdTech - She shared insights on the role of technology in driving learning.
  3. Special Guest: Prof Khem Singh Daheriya, Chairman of the Madhya Pradesh Private University Regulatory Commission (MPPURC) - He stressed on the importance of regulatory excellence in higher education.

Other prominent guests included Padma Shri awardee and Chancellor, Dr Sanjay Dhande, and Vice Chancellor Dr Nitin Rane, who graced the dais to congratulate the graduates on their journey from design thinkers to industry-ready professionals.

SAMAHVAN 2025: Empowering the Next Generation of Indian Innovators

UG / PG graduates from Avantika's School of Design, Engineering, Management and Liberal Arts were awarded their degrees during the cultural show, student testimonial and awards for research excellence. The convocation focused on Avantika's commitment to design-led education aligned towards NEP 2020, fostering skills in AI, sustainability and creative problem-solving.

Chancellor Dr Sanjay Dhande highlighted how a vision has grown into a thriving academic institution with over 1,600 students from across India, earning national and international recognition. He also emphasised the university’s guiding principle of collaboration over competition, which continues to define its academic culture. Degrees awarded included BDes, BTech and MBA with gold medals for the top performers in sustainable design and digital innovation.
